拥有一个快速的网站将使您的客户体验您的服务和产品。在关注电子商务平台的性能时,请从以下八个技巧开始。
值得信赖的电子商务研究和案例研究表明,建议的网站加载速度不应超过3秒。实际上,网站加载的时间越长,转化率,跳出率,用户会话时长和其他KPI越差。
ThinkWithGoogle声称负面的用户体验将重复购买的机会降低了60%。对于在线商店的移动版本而言,加载速度较慢的后果较少考虑,这是它对搜索结果排名的负面影响。由于加载速度慢,搜索引擎可能没有时间完全索引页面。
网站加载速度可能受到许多因素的影响,例如页面的权重,未优化的图像,太多的服务器请求,缓慢的托管,错误的代码等等。
在本文中,我们将讨论网站优化技术,这些技术可以极大地加快您的电子商务网站的速度,并使您的电子商务业务更上一层楼。
如何加快您的电子商务网站
调查效果不佳
更改托管
开始使用CDN
限制页面大小
减少HTTP请求
优化第一个字节的时间(TTFB)
修改第三方扩展
监督网站效果
1.调查表现不佳
在开始之前,让我们澄清一下,站点加载速度应理解为单个页面的加载速度。它不属于整个站点。不同类型的页面可能包含不同数量的内容,CSS和JS文件以及图像。因此,每页的权重将略有不同,这意味着这些页面将需要不同的时间才能完全加载。
几乎不可能检查在线商店的每个页面。因此,要运行质量绩效分析,您应该分别分析主页,类别页面和产品页面。这些是最经常出现的客户切入点,应始终表现完美。
现在,让我们看看如何找到电子商务网站性能的瓶颈。
PageSpeed Insights是Google提供的免费工具。它可以用来确定您的网站页面在台式机和移动设备上的加载速度。简而言之,该服务可衡量您网站的关键性能指标,并将其与“ Chrome用户体验报告”进行比较。结果,您看到的是所选页面的平均加载速度,分数的得分是1到100,以100为目标。
较低的结果意味着您的网站需要改进。在这种情况下,PageSpeed Insights就如何改进检测到的问题给出了具体建议。该工具的开发人员指南包含有关该服务的许多有用信息。
GTMetrix是与PageSpeed Insights和YSlow集成的服务。该工具以方便且有条理的方式提供信息,指示到检测到问题的位置的链接,有关解决问题的方法的全面说明以及更多有用的功能。
注册后,用户可以手动更改虚拟主机的位置,并了解从世界各地加载网站的速度。此外,GTMetrix功能允许注册用户保存检查历史记录,以便以后分析性能变化。
既然您知道了如何找到在线商店绩效中的瓶颈,那么现在该是找出如何解决它们的时候了。
2.更改托管
电子商务初创公司通常会为其在线商店选择最便宜的托管服务。但是,随着在线商店的发展和流量的增长,商家面临着升级其托管计划甚至更改托管提供商的需求。
根据在线商店的类型和大小,有几种托管选项可供选择:
共享主机:此选项适用于产品数量少的小型电子商务初创公司。如果您使用共享托管,则意味着您与在同一位置托管的其他网站共享其资源(CPU,RAM等)。
VPS托管结合了共享托管和专用托管的功能。使用此选项,您仍然可以与多个站点共享一个主机,但是同时,还为您提供了服务器资源的一些专用部分。
专用服务器是最昂贵的选择,但是在这种情况下,将为您提供对托管的完全控制权,并为其提供足够的资源来启动和运行大型电子商务商店。
无论选择哪种服务,请确保找到最适合您网站需求的服务。不要开箱即用。使用适合您的解决方案。
3.开始使用CDN
优化网站性能的另一种流行方法是使用CDN(内容交付网络)。这样的网络由位于世界不同地区的众多服务器组成。
启用CDN后,您的网站文件将被复制并存储在这些服务器上。当来自不同大陆(甚至国家)的用户到达您的在线商店时,所有数据将从最近的服务器加载,从而使网站加载速度更快。
如上图所示,由于有许多服务器,因此您的网站可以在全球范围内使用。CDN也适用于所有类型的网站,但是对于高流量的电子商务网站而言,它是一个完美的解决方案。由于性能指标的优化,它还提高了搜索引擎排名。
通常,CDN连接旨在提高总体网站速度并促进网站的长期维护。
4.限制页面大小
显然,页面越重,加载每个页面所花费的时间就越长。任何页面大小取决于HTML和CSS文件,图像,脚本以及添加到页面的所有媒体的数量。
以下是一些有关如何使页面大小保持最小的提示:
查看您网站上的所有资源,并删除所有未使用的脚本,插件和字体。
优化图像。您可以删除过多的图像,将其压缩,将其转换为WebP,用SVG中的图像替换现有图像,生成小图像和图标的精灵,等等。
合并并缩小JS和CSS文件。虽然代码精简有助于减少多余或错误的代码段,但合并有助于减少服务器请求的数量,从而加快页面加载时间。
由于图像是网页的很大一部分,因此找到实现这些图像的最简单方法可以显着提高网站速度,同时使您的平台易于使用。
现在,让我们看看可以使用哪些其他方法来减少HTTP请求的数量。
5.减少HTTP请求
页面包含的元素越多,浏览器向服务器发送的请求越多,并且对加载速度的影响也越大。要打破这种恶性循环并减少HTTP请求的数量,可以采取几种方法。
删除不必要的扩展名,图像和其他文件是第一步。接下来,借助CSS Sprites生成器,CssSpritegen,Spritebox等工具,将几个小元素(图像,按钮,图标)组合到一个CSS Sprite中。
缓存是另一种技术。每次客户访问您的网站时,他们的浏览器都会从服务器加载所有文件。根据您使用的CMS,您可能会有不同的缓存机会。
例如,如果您运行基于WordPress + WooCommerce组合的小型电子商务商店,则可以借助第三方插件(例如WP Super Cache,W3 Total Cache或Hyper Cache)来启用缓存。
Magento 2是大中型企业的更好选择,商人可以获得开箱即用的12种以上的缓存类型。
6.优化到第一个字节的时间(TTFB)
到达第一字节的时间(TTFB)是HTTP请求从其服务器接收其第一位数据所花费的时间。如下图所示,某些网站花费的时间比其他网站更长。
优化到第一个字节的时间来源
TTFB是唯一被搜索引擎认为关键的时间间隔。Google表示TTFB不应超过200毫秒。在初始请求和接收数据的第一个字节之间必须执行三个步骤:
DNS查询
服务器处理
服务器响应
如果用户晚于200毫秒从服务器获得第一响应,则应改进此指示符。可以通过配置服务器或动态内容创建来解决缓存问题。
7.修改第三方扩展
扩展和插件用于增强电子商务商店的功能。不幸的是,尽管其中一些可能一方面会有所帮助,另一方面却可能对您的网站造成损害。大量的自定义功能,以及质量低劣,错误代码和第三方集成中发现的其他问题,可能会严重降低网站的速度。
首先修改所有第三方功能。您可能不得不权衡一些利弊。然后删除未使用的插件和未提供足够有用功能的插件。您还可以修复导致网站操作错误的插件中的代码。
8.监督网站性能
一旦您完成了性能优化,并且当前的网站加载时间完全可以满足您的需求,请不要太过自豪,因为这并不意味着您将再也不会遇到此问题。
每当您将新产品添加到商店中,在网站设计中进行什至是微小的更改或对该平台的自定义功能进行重大更改时,都会影响性能。因此,您应该使用上述工具之一不断跟踪性能指标。
这始终使您有机会立即做出反应,甚至消除最微小的问题,以免损害您的网站。
继续监视在线商店的改进
性能优化是一个热门话题。全世界在线生活商店的绝大部分都可以而且应该得到改善。
不幸的是,由于网站运行缓慢,大多数电子商务企业主常常会错失此类机会并继续失去客户。如果您遇到性能方面的任何问题,现在您就有机会将事情做得更好,并在竞争者中领先一步
即使不是一个精通技术的人,本文中列出的大多数技巧也可以轻松实现。您所需要做的就是具有CMS的基本知识,并花几个小时来查找和消除主要的性能瓶颈。